How to Make Fat Free Blueberry Cottage Cheesecake

  1. Preheat oven to 375°F (190°C).
  2. In a medium bowl, combine 1 cup graham cracker crumbs and 6 tablespoons (3 ounces) melted unsalted butter. Press firmly into the bottom of a 9-inch pie plate.
  3. Bake the crust for 5-7 minutes, or until lightly golden brown. Let cool completely.
  4. In a blender, combine 16 ounces (2 cups) small-curd cottage cheese, 1/2 cup fresh blueberries, 1/4 cup Splenda (or equivalent sweetener), 2 tablespoons milk, and 2 tablespoons plain Greek yogurt. Blend until completely smooth and creamy.
  5. Pour the cottage cheese mixture into the cooled crust.
  6. Bake for 45 minutes, or until the cheesecake is set around the edges but still slightly jiggly in the center.
  7. Meanwhile, prepare the topping: In a small blender or food processor, combine 1 cup fresh blueberries, 1/4 cup Splenda (or equivalent sweetener), and 2 tablespoons unsweetened applesauce. Blend until smooth.
  8. Pour the blueberry topping over the baked cheesecake.
  9. Bake for an additional 5 minutes.
  10. Let the cheesecake cool completely on a wire rack before refrigerating for at least 4 hours, or preferably overnight, to allow it to set completely.
